Shawn MacDonald, Ph.D.

Chief Executive Officer

Shawn MacDonald is a leading expert in labor and human rights policy, with more than 25 years of experience advising multinational companies, governments, and international institutions in labor rights and multisector partnerships.

As CEO of Verité since 2016, he guides the organization’s global mission to eradicate the most severe labor and human rights abuses in global supply chains. Shawn joined Verité in 2003 when he led the organization’s research, program development, and policy initiatives before becoming CEO. His work has shaped policy approaches to forced labor prevention and legal enforcement frameworks across multiple government administrations.

His expertise in labor rights, social entrepreneurship, and multi-sector partnerships has been cultivated through diverse leadership roles including Director of Accreditation at the Fair Labor Association, Vice President at Ashoka, and Senior Advisor at Meridian Group International. As co-founder of the Development and Employment Policy Project, Shawn developed innovative approaches to worker protection and economic development.

Shawn’s early career includes serving as founding director of WorldTeach Poland and as a Rockefeller Fellow. His academic foundation includes a Ph.D. from George Mason University’s Carter School for Peace and Conflict Resolution, where his research examined conflict management between multinational corporations and civil society in labor and environmental disputes. He also holds an AB magna cum laude in History from Harvard University.
